Run a Utilization report to evaluate the percentage of time each unit in your fleet has been in use. Utilization is an important metric for you to monitor weekly and monthly in order to help determine your business's efficiency, the need to add to or remove from your fleet, and to properly rotate units. Criteria for inclusion

The Utilization Report includes units, including shuttles, owned by the current location that were in service on at least one day of the reporting date rage, based on the unit’s Service Start Date. So, if you run the report from December 1st to December 31st, a unit is only included in results if it was in service any time during that period.

The following calendar days are not counted toward the "In Service Days" portion of utilization calculations:

  • Days a unit has the Flagged for Auto Removal status.
  • Days after a Removed From Fleet unit's Service End Date.
  • Days on which a unit spends the entirety with one or more "Exclude From Utilization" statuses, as determined by the manufacturer's setting (e.g., Pending Import Details, On Maintenance, Recall, and/or Body Shop), if applicable.

When it comes to counting Agreement Days (calendar days during which a unit was In Use on an agreement), the report considers all open and closed agreements. The following calendar days are not counted toward the "Agreement Days" portion of utilization calculations:

  • Days a unit is In Use on a Shuttle or Internal Use agreement, if your location uses these types of agreements.
  • Days a unit is In Use on an agreement that was later voided.
  • Days a unit is In Use on an agreement of a certain Classification, as determined by your manufacturer's setting, if applicable.

The unit's status is taken into account as of midnight (12:00AM) on the reporting End Date (if in the past), or as of the time you run the report (if the End Date is today).

Idle Days Number of days during the reporting period that the unit has been idle (not In Use), since the last time it was on an agreement. For example, if a unit was returned from an agreement three days ago, and hasn't been assigned (In Use) since, then it would have three "Idle Days".

Agreement Days

The number of Agreement Days attributed to the unit during the reporting period.

An Agreement Day (also known as "In Use Day" or "Contract Day") is defined as a single calendar day during which a unit is In Use on an agreement (excluding Internal Use agreements, if applicable). (Calendar days increment each day at midnight, not on a 24-hour clock starting from the Checkout Date/Time.)

If a unit is assigned to two agreements in one calendar day, each agreement is counted as a separate agreement day; that's two (2) Agreement Days for that unit. (Therefore, when used to calculate utilization, utilization can become higher than 100%.)

Example: During the month of February, a unit is assigned to an agreement A1 from 2/01 - 2/03, agreement A2 from 2/14 - 2/21, and agreement A3 from 2/21 - 2/22. In this case, the unit has 13 Agreement Days for February (3 + 8 + 2).

Agreement Count Number of agreements, excluding Internal Use agreements, to which the unit has been assigned in the reporting period
In Service Days The number of days in which the unit has been in service during the reporting period
Unit Utilization Utilization percentage value for the unit, rounded to two decimal places: (Agreement Days ÷ In-Service Days) * 100. See "Utilization" for more information about calculations, including units and agreements that may or may not impact utilization.
